VMware能否实现多机同时使用?

vmware可以同时使用吗

时间:2025-01-15 06:49


VMware可以同时使用吗:深度解析与多场景应用实践 在虚拟化技术的广阔天地中,VMware无疑是一颗璀璨的明星

    自其诞生以来,VMware凭借其强大的虚拟化能力、高效的资源管理和灵活的部署方案,在数据中心、云计算、开发测试等多个领域大放异彩

    然而,对于许多用户而言,一个核心问题始终萦绕心头:VMware能否在同一环境中或不同环境中同时使用,以实现更高效的资源利用和业务拓展?本文将从技术原理、实际应用场景及最佳实践三个方面,深入探讨VMware的同时使用问题,为您揭开这一技术神秘的面纱

     一、技术原理:VMware架构的并发性与兼容性 VMware的核心技术在于其虚拟化层(Hypervisor),这一层位于物理硬件与操作系统之间,负责将物理资源抽象成多个虚拟资源,使得多个虚拟机(VM)能够在同一物理机上并行运行

    VMware Workstation、VMware ESXi、VMware Fusion等产品均基于这一架构构建,它们之间的主要区别在于目标用户群、应用场景以及管理功能的复杂度

     1.VMware ESXi:专为数据中心设计,提供高性能、高可用性的虚拟化解决方案

    ESXi运行在裸机上,几乎不占用任何系统资源,能够支持大规模虚拟环境的管理和部署

     2.VMware Workstation:面向个人用户和专业开发者,提供了丰富的虚拟化功能,如快照、克隆、虚拟网络配置等,非常适合于开发测试、教学演示等场景

     3.VMware Fusion:专为Mac用户设计的虚拟化软件,允许在Mac上运行Windows及其他操作系统,实现跨平台操作的无缝切换

     从技术层面看,VMware的这些产品均具备并发运行的能力,即可以在同一台物理机上同时运行多个虚拟机

    此外,VMware还通过vSphere套件提供了跨物理机的虚拟化资源管理,使得不同物理服务器上的虚拟机可以作为一个统一的资源池进行管理,进一步增强了虚拟环境的灵活性和可扩展性

     二、实际应用场景:VMware同时使用的多种可能 VMware的同时使用不仅限于单一物理机上的多虚拟机运行,更涵盖了跨物理机、跨数据中心乃至跨云环境的复杂应用

    以下是一些典型的应用场景: 1.开发测试环境:在软件开发周期中,开发者常需在不同操作系统、不同版本环境中测试应用程序

    利用VMware Workstation或Fusion,可以在单个工作站上快速创建并运行多个虚拟机,模拟各种测试场景,极大地提高了开发效率和代码质量

     2.服务器整合与迁移:企业数据中心常面临服务器数量众多、资源利用率低的问题

    通过VMware ESXi和vSphere,可以将多台物理服务器整合到少数几台高性能服务器上,实现资源的集中管理和优化利用

    同时,VMware的迁移技术(如vMotion)允许在不中断服务的情况下,将虚拟机从一个物理服务器迁移到另一个,增强了系统的灵活性和可靠性

     3.混合云与多云部署:随着云计算的普及,越来越多的企业开始采用混合云或多云策略,以充分利用不同云服务提供商的优势

    VMware Cloud on AWS、VMware Cloud Foundation等解决方案,使得企业能够将VMware环境无缝扩展到公有云上,实现私有云与公有云之间的资源互通与统一管理,极大地简化了跨云部署和运维的复杂度

     4.灾难恢复与业务连续性:VMware的Site Recovery Manager(SRM)等灾难恢复解决方案,利用虚拟化技术的优势,实现了跨地理位置的虚拟机复制和自动故障切换,确保了业务在遭遇自然灾害、硬件故障等意外情况时的连续运行,有效降低了企业的运营风险

     三、最佳实践:实现VMware高效并用的策略 尽管VMware提供了强大的虚拟化能力,但在实际应用中,仍需遵循一定的最佳实践,以确保虚拟环境的稳定性、安全性和性能优化: 1.合理规划资源:在部署虚拟机前,应根据业务需求合理规划CPU、内存、存储等资源,避免资源过度分配导致的性能瓶颈

     2.实施高可用性策略:利用VMware的HA(High Availability)功能,确保在物理主机故障时,虚拟机能够迅速在其他主机上重启,减少服务中断时间

     3.定期备份与恢复测试:定期对虚拟机进行备份,并定期进行恢复测试,确保备份数据的可用性和恢复过程的顺畅

     4.安全隔离与策略执行:通过VMware NSX等网络虚拟化技术,实现虚拟机之间的安全隔离,同时执行严格的安全策略,防止恶意攻击和数据泄露

     5.持续优化与监控:利用VMware的监控工具(如vCenter Operations Manager)持续监控虚拟环境的性能指标,及时发现并解决潜在问题,实现资源的持续优化

     总之,VMware不仅支持在同一物理机或不同物理机上同时使用多个虚拟机,更通过其丰富的功能和强大的生态系统,为企业提供了从本地到云端、从单一应用到复杂业务系统的全面虚拟化解决方案

    遵循最佳实践,企业可以充分利用VMware的技术优势,实现资源的最大化利用,推动业务的快速发展和创新